Born 11 November 1996 · Elkhart, Texas, USA

Tye Kayle Sheridan is an American actor. His breakout role came in 2012 with his critically acclaimed performance in Jeff Nichols' "Mud," where he starred alongside Matthew McConaughey and Reese Witherspoon. His portrayal earned him a Critics' Choice nomination for Best Young Actor and further solidified his reputation as a promising actor.

In 2013, Sheridan's talent was recognized on an international stage when he won the Marcello Mastroianni Award at the Venice Film Festival for his role in David Gordon Green's "Joe." This accolade propelled him further into the spotlight and opened doors to a wider range of opportunities.
